Pronounced metastable peaks are observed for the two‐stage decomposition and the multi ‐ stage elimination from p ‐NO 2 C 6 H 4 (CH 2 ) n CO 2 H (n>1). 2 H and 18 O labelling shows that each process involves elimination of atoms from both the nitro and carboxyl groups. A consideration of the spectrum of p ‐nitrophenylcyclohexane‐4‐carboxylic acid leads to the proposition that interaction between the two functional groups is not a necessary prerequisite for the elimination of HO⋅.
